td.samiytop {font: 65% Tahoma; color: #808080; text-align: right; padding-right: 20;}
td.samiytop a {text-decoration: none; color: #1A2E5F;}
td.samiytop a:hover {text-decoration: underline; color: #ff0000;}


table.lmenu {}
table.lmenu td {font: 70% Tahoma; padding: 5 5 5 15;}
table.lmenu td.polosa {font: 70% Tahoma; padding: 5 5 5 15; font-weight: bold; background-color: #efefef;}
table.lmenu a {color: #404040;}
table.lmenu td.sep {padding: 0 0 0 0; background-color: #cccccc; height: 1;}

div.uphead {font: 70% Tahoma; color: #808080; font-weight: bold; text-align: left; margin-top: 7;}
div.head {font: 100% Arial; font-weight: bold; text-align: left; margin-top: 0; color: #cc0000;}
div.head a {color: #cc0000; text-decoration: none;}
div.head a:hover {color: #cc0000; text-decoration: underline;}

div.unhead {padding: 0 0 0 2; FONT: 70% Tahoma; COLOR: #404040; text-align: top;}
div.unhead a {COLOR: #404040;}
div.unhead a:hover {COLOR: #cc0000;}

div.vvodka {font: 80% Arial; font-weight: normal; margin: 7 0 10 0;}
div.vvodka a {color: #203020; text-decoration: none;}
div.vvodka a:hover {color: #404040; text-decoration: underline;}
div.vvodka a:visited {color: #404040;}


h2 {font: 130% Arial; font-weight: bold; color: #ef0000; border-bottom: 1px solid #efefef;}
h3 {font: 100% Arial; font-weight: bold; color: #ef0000; border-bottom: 1px solid #efefef;}

div.m-onhead {padding: 7 0 0 2; FONT: 70% Tahoma; COLOR: #cc0000; font-weight: bold;  text-align: top; height: 20;}

.m-head, h1.m-head {padding: 0 0 0 0; FONT: 140% Arial; COLOR: #1A2E5F;  text-align: top; margin: 0;}
.m-head a {color: #1A2E5F; text-decoration: none;}
.m-head a:hover {color: #cc0000; text-decoration: underline;}

div.m-unhead {padding: 0 0 0 2; FONT: 70% Tahoma; COLOR: #404040; text-align: top; height: 20;}


td.maincontent {font-size: 100%; vertical-align: top; padding: 0 0 0 0;}
td.mainhead {padding: 33 20 0 20;}
form {margin: 0 0 0 0;}

div.qlink  a {color: #1A2E5F;}
div.alllink  {FONT: 70% Tahoma; color: #1A2E5F;}
div.alllink  a { color: #1A2E5F;}
div.alllink  a:hover {color: #cc0000;}

table.nums td {font: 10 Tahoma; padding: 0 0 0 0;}
table.nums td a {width: 13; height: 13; text-decoration: none; color: #ffffff; text-align: center; vertical-align: bottom; padding: 1 2 1 2;}


div.author {font: 80% Tahoma;}
div.author a {color: #cc0000;}
div.numbern {font: 80% Tahoma;}
div.numbern a {color: #1A2E5F; text-decoration: none;}
div.numbern a:hover {color: #cc0000; text-decoration: underline;}

div.numberlist {color: #404040;  text-decoration: none;}
div.numberlist a {color: #1A2E5F; text-decoration: none;}
div.numberlist a:hover {color: #cc0000; text-decoration: underline;}
div.numberlist span.number {font-size: 80%;}
div.archnumber {color: #404040;  text-decoration: none;}
div.archnumber a {color: #1A2E5F; text-decoration: none;}
div.archnumber a:hover {color: #cc0000; text-decoration: underline;}

div.podr {font: 80% Tahoma; text-align: right; margin: 5 5 15 5;}
div.podr a {color: #808080; font-weight: bold; text-decoration: none;}
div.podr a:hover {color: #cc0000; font-weight: bold; text-decoration: none;}

table.form td.what {font: 70% Tahoma; text-align: right; vertical-align: top; padding-top: 7; color: #202020;}

table.forum td div.head {padding: 0 10 0 10; FONT: 110% Arial; COLOR: #1A2E5F;  text-align: top; height: 25;}
table.forum td div.head a {color: #1A2E5F; text-decoration: none; width: 100%}
table.forum td a:hover {color: #cc0000; text-decoration: underline;}
table.forumg {background-color: #f6f6f6;}
table.forumg td {font: 70% Tahoma; color: #404040; padding: 2 10 2 10;}

div.comm_time {font: 80% Tahoma; font-weight: normal; background-color: #f7f7f7; padding: 5 5 5 5;}
div.comm_auth {font-size: 110%; color: #1A2E5F; font-weight: bold; background-color: #f7f7f7; padding: 0 5 5 5;}
div.comm_auth a {color: #1A2E5F;}
div.comm_text {padding: 10 5 5 5;}

table.listalka {font: 10 Tahoma; text-align: center; padding: 0 2 0 2; color: #ff4000;}
table.listalka a {text-decoration: none; color: #808080;}
table.listalka a:hover {text-decoration: none; color: #000000;}


table.valuta
{
  padding: 0px;
  margin: 0px;
}
table.valuta td
{
  font: 80% Tahoma;
  padding: 7 0 7 1;
  background-color: #ffffff;
}
table.valuta td.bankname
{
  font: 80% Tahoma;
  padding: 1 1 1 7;
  font-weight: bold;
  color: #000000;
}
table.valuta td.bankname span.phone
{
  font: 80% Tahoma;
  font-weight: normal;
  color: #373A3F;
}
table.valuta th
{
  font: 80% Tahoma;
  font-weight: bold;
  background-color: #757b81;
  color: #ffffff;
  padding: 1 1 1 1;
  border-top: solid 1 #b6b9bf;
  border-left: solid 1 #b6b9bf;
}
table.valuta td.sep
{
  margin: 0 0 0 0;
  padding: 0 0 0 0;
  height: 1;
  background-color: #efefef;
}
table.valuta td.sep img
{
  margin: 0 0 0 0;
  padding: 0;
}


table.white {background-color: #cccccc;}
table.white td {background-color: #ffffff; font: 75% Tahoma; padding: 3 3 3 3;}

table.ib-tmenu td  {color: #ffffff; padding: 5 2 0 2;}
table.topmenu2 td  {font: 10 Tahoma; color: #ffffff; padding: 5 2 0 2;}
table.topmenu2 td a {color: #ffffff; text-decoration: none;}
table.ib-tmenu td.sep  {color: #efefef; padding: 6 5 0 5; font-weight: bold;}
table.ib-tmenu td a {font: 10 Tahoma; color: #ffffff; text-decoration: none;}
table.ib-tmenu td a:hover {font: 10 Tahoma; color: #ffffff; text-decoration: underline;}

div.dosie {background-color: #efefef; padding: 20 20 20 20;}
div.dosie h2 {font: 130% Arial; font-weight: bold; color: #000000; border-bottom: 1px solid #cccccc; margin-top: 0;}
